Giddy Timothee Chalamet and Kylie Jenner jet off for romantic break amid actor’s historic Oscars nod

Timothée Chalamet and Kylie Jenner were spotted jetting off for a romantic getaway just one day before the actor made Oscar history.
The loved-up couple looked relaxed and stunning as they arrived hand-in-hand at a private airport terminal in Los Angeles, where they were seen boarding a stylish private jet together.
For their flight, Chalamet wore a casual outfit with dark sweatpants, sneakers and a backpack, while Jenner wore black leggings and a light gray hoodie and carried a large beige bag.
In exclusive footage obtained by The Daily Mail, the pair walk side by side on the tarmac, chatting and laughing as they approach the plane.
At one point, Jenner climbed the steps of the jet first, Chalamet followed closely behind, and the couple disappeared inside together.
The escape took place just hours before Chalamet, 30, earned his third Best Actor Oscar nomination for his role in Marty Supreme.

The film has emerged as one of this year’s biggest Academy Awards contenders, with nine nominations including Best Picture, Best Director, Best Actor, Best Original Screenplay, Best Cinematography and Best Film Editing.
Shortly after the nominations were announced Thursday morning, Chalamet celebrated the milestone on Instagram, reposting the nod news and writing: ‘BIG DREAAAAM!!!!!’
While sharing the film’s poster and reminding audiences that Marty Supreme will be released in IMAX theaters on January 30, he shared another post encouraging fans to “dream big.”
With his nomination, Chalamet became the youngest actor to win three Best Actor awards since Marlon Brando in the 1950s.
He was first nominated in 2018 for the movie Call Me by Your Name, and in 2025 for his role as Bob Dylan in A Complete Unknown. He lost to Adrien Brody in The Brutalist last year.
The actor has previously been candid about the emotional pain of awards season losses.
‘If there are five people at an awards ceremony and four people go home losing, those four people are going to be at the restaurant saying, ‘Damn, didn’t we win?’ You don’t think. he said Vogue In November 2025. ‘People can call me tough and say whatever. But it’s actually me doing this here.’
He echoed that sentiment during an appearance on SiriusXM, joking that it was “uniquely funny” to go home empty-handed after preparing an acceptance speech.
